  • Publication number: 20060056327
    Abstract: An adaptive pre-equalizer is disclosed to compensate amplitude ripples in a low cost transmitter pass-band filter. A filtered-x LMS algorithm is proposed to calculate the equalizer coefficients. To this purpose, the modulated RF signal is demodulated at the transmitter and subtracted from a filtered version of the original base band signal. The impulse response of the low-cost transmit filter is approximated by a delay. The disclosure may be applied to direct conversion or heterodyne transmitters using OFDM.

  • Publication number: 20050201483
    Abstract: A processing device and method for an error adjustment system for equalizing transmission characteristics of N signal processing circuitries according to N signal branches (N>1) are disclosed. An original complex IQ signal of a signal branch of N signal branches and a processed real signal of the signal branch are received. A processed complex IQ signal of the signal branch is calculated from the processed real signal and the original complex IQ signal of the signal branch. Then, a difference between the processed complex IQ signal and the original complex IQ signal is calculated. Finally, control values of a correction function of the signal branch are calculated on the basis of the calculated difference. The calculated control values are supplied to the correction function of the signal branch. The receiving, calculating and supplying operations are performed for all N signal branches.

  • Publication number: 20050152476
    Abstract: A receiving method and a direct conversion receiver are provided. The receiver comprises a mixer (308) for mixing a received signal into a base band signal com-prising I and Q branches, and an A/D converter (316) for converting the base band signal into digital form, and a phase adjuster (318) for performing a frequency selective IQ phase error estimation and for correcting the digitised signal with frequency selective correction factors based on the error estimation.

  • Publication number: 20040193965
    Abstract: An error adjustment method of equalizing transmission characteristics of a signal processing circuitry is disclosed. In a first step, an original complex IQ signal is generated, on which error adjustment is performed. Then, the adjusted complex IQ signal is processed in the signal processing circuitry, thereby obtaining a processed real signal. The envelope of the real signal is detected and this real signal envelope and the original complex IQ signal are synchronized. The envelope of the original complex IQ signal is derived and the synchronized real signal envelope is compared with the synchronized original IQ signal envelope at two consecutive time instances. Finally, a processed complex IQ signal is obtained from the real signal envelope on the basis of the comparison result, which processed complex IQ signal is used in performing error adjustment.
